The main topic centers on burnout:

  • Recognizing the signs and symptoms of burnout, especially for women.
  • Personal stories about stressful jobs, health impacts, and the difficulty of noticing burnout while it's happening.
  • Discussion of physical and emotional symptoms: fatigue, poor concentration, frequent illness, headaches, stomach issues, changes in appetite, cynicism, detachment, and more.
  • The importance of understanding your own "normal" and noticing when things change.
  • Strategies for coping: recognizing the problem, making a plan, journaling, getting out in nature, talking to friends or professionals, and finding relaxing activities.
  • Emphasis on self-kindness, setting boundaries, and sometimes saying "no" to protect your well-being.
